About The Company & OpportunityJoin a well-established and growing organization whose products can be found in major retail stores nationwide. This is an excellent opportunity for an accounting professional looking to join a collaborative, high-performing team within a company that emphasizes innovation, teamwork, and a healthy work-life balance. This is an exciting opportunity for a hands-on Controller to join a collaborative, high-performing team and play a key role in overseeing the company’s accounting and financial operations.
The ideal candidate will bring strong technical accounting skills, a detail-oriented approach, and the ability to partner with leadership in a fast-paced, growth-oriented retail environment.
- Lead the monthly, quarterly, and year-end close processes and financial statement preparation
- Oversee day-to-day accounting operations, including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, and reconciliations
- Manage cash flow forecasting, reporting, and working capital
- Oversee inventory accounting and support the financial reporting needs of a retail/distribution business
- Manage payroll, intercompany accounting, and related financial processes
- Prepare financial analysis, reporting, and insights for senior leadership
- Develop and maintain strong internal controls and accounting policies
- Supervise, mentor, and develop the accounting team
- Partner cross-functionally with operations, sales, supply chain, and other business leaders
- Support budgeting, forecasting, audit, tax, and other financial initiatives
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field
- 5+ years of progressive accounting experience, including Controller or Assistant Controller-level responsibility
- Experience with in retail, consumer products, beauty, cosmetics, CPG, or distribution strongly preferred
- Strong understanding of inventory accounting and financial reporting
- Experience working with companies experiencing growth and increasing operational complexity
- Advanced Excel skills
- Experience with ERP/accounting systems and financial reporting tools
- Hands-on, detail-oriented leadership style with strong business judgment
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ial environment
